Shrub Selection for Sunny and Shady Gardens

When selecting shrubs for your garden, it's crucial to take into account both the sunlight availability of the area and your personal preferences. Bright gardens offer a selection of options, from vibrant flowering shrubs like hydrangeas to evergreen picks such as boxwoods and yews. On the other hand, shady gardens require vegetation that can flourish in low light, like hostas, ferns, or viburnums.

Designing Layered Landscapes with Perennials, Shrubs, and Ferns

Crafting a layered landscape brimming with color involves strategically integrating diverse plant selections. Perennials provide vibrant showers throughout the season, while shrubs offer structure and evergreen appeal. Incorporating ferns adds a touch of serenity with their delicate foliage, creating a harmonious tapestry that captivates the senses.

  • Start by envisioning your ideal landscape concept. Consider the scale of your space and the level of sunlight it receives.
  • Locate taller shrubs at the far end to establish a visual base, gradually lowering in height as you move towards the near.
  • Incorporate perennials with varying bloom times to ensure continuous interest throughout the growing season. Ferns thrive in shaded areas, adding a touch of intrigue to your landscape.
